Yes, bamboo can be grown in pots or containers, but it requires proper care to thrive in these confined spaces:
Choose the right variety: Smaller clumping types such as Fargesia are better suited to containers. Running types need larger pots and root barriers to prevent spreading.
Large containers: Bamboo needs a large, deep pot (at least 45 cm wide and deep) to accommodate the root system.
Watering and feeding: Bamboo in containers requires regular watering and fertilization. Ensure good drainage and avoid soggy conditions to prevent root rot.
Repotting: Bamboo will need repotting every 2-3 years as it outgrows its container.
Summary: Bamboo can grow in pots, but choose the right size container and maintain regular care.
